做了公式的excel怎么复制粘贴

做了公式的excel怎么复制粘贴

在Excel中复制粘贴公式的方法有多种,包括直接复制粘贴、使用快捷键、以及通过粘贴选项来控制粘贴内容。以下详细介绍这些方法以及在实际应用中的注意事项。

一、直接复制粘贴

直接复制粘贴是最常见的方法。只需选择包含公式的单元格,按下Ctrl+C进行复制,然后选择目标单元格,按下Ctrl+V进行粘贴。这种方法最简单快捷,适用于大多数场景

二、使用快捷键

使用快捷键是提高效率的重要手段。Ctrl+C进行复制,Ctrl+V进行粘贴。如果只想粘贴公式,可以使用Ctrl+Shift+V,然后选择“公式”选项。

三、通过粘贴选项控制粘贴内容

粘贴选项让你可以选择粘贴公式、值、格式等内容。复制后,在目标单元格右键单击,选择“粘贴选项”中的“公式”图标,这样只会粘贴公式,不会改变单元格格式。

四、复制粘贴公式的实际应用

复制粘贴公式时,最重要的就是理解相对引用和绝对引用的区别。相对引用会根据粘贴位置自动调整,而绝对引用则保持不变。了解这一点可以避免公式粘贴后的错误。

五、如何避免常见问题

复制粘贴公式时常见问题包括单元格引用错误、格式丢失等。可以通过使用“粘贴选项”来避免这些问题。

六、实际操作示例

以下是一些实际操作示例,帮助你更好地理解和应用上述方法。

一、直接复制粘贴

直接复制粘贴是最常见和简单的方法。这种方法适用于大多数场景,尤其是当公式较为简单时。具体步骤如下:

  1. 选择包含公式的单元格或单元格范围。
  2. 按下Ctrl+C键进行复制。
  3. 选择目标单元格或单元格范围。
  4. 按下Ctrl+V键进行粘贴。

这种方法的优点是操作简单快捷,但也有一些潜在的问题。例如,复制粘贴时,可能会因为单元格引用方式不正确而导致公式计算结果错误。

二、使用快捷键

使用快捷键可以大大提高工作效率,特别是在需要频繁进行复制粘贴操作时。以下是一些常用的快捷键:

  • Ctrl+C:复制
  • Ctrl+V:粘贴
  • Ctrl+X:剪切
  • Ctrl+Shift+V:粘贴特殊

使用Ctrl+Shift+V可以打开“粘贴特殊”对话框,你可以选择只粘贴公式、值、格式等内容。这样可以更精确地控制粘贴内容,避免一些不必要的问题。

三、通过粘贴选项控制粘贴内容

在粘贴公式时,有时需要只粘贴公式,而不改变目标单元格的格式。这时可以使用“粘贴选项”。具体步骤如下:

  1. 复制包含公式的单元格。
  2. 在目标单元格右键单击。
  3. 在弹出的菜单中选择“粘贴选项”。
  4. 选择“公式”图标。

这样只会粘贴公式,不会改变单元格的格式。这种方法适用于需要保留目标单元格格式的情况。

四、复制粘贴公式的实际应用

复制粘贴公式时,最重要的是理解相对引用和绝对引用的区别。相对引用会根据粘贴位置自动调整,而绝对引用则保持不变。具体来说:

  • 相对引用(如A1)会根据粘贴位置自动调整。例如,如果在B1单元格中复制公式=A1,然后粘贴到C1,则公式会自动变为=B1。
  • 绝对引用(如$A$1)则保持不变,无论粘贴到哪个位置,公式中引用的单元格始终是A1。

了解这一点可以避免公式粘贴后的错误。例如,如果公式中涉及的单元格需要保持不变,可以使用绝对引用。

五、如何避免常见问题

复制粘贴公式时,常见问题包括单元格引用错误、格式丢失等。可以通过以下方法避免这些问题:

  1. 使用绝对引用:在公式中使用绝对引用可以确保粘贴后单元格引用不变。
  2. 使用“粘贴选项”:通过“粘贴选项”选择只粘贴公式,可以避免格式丢失。
  3. 检查公式:粘贴后检查公式是否正确,确保计算结果无误。

六、实际操作示例

以下是一些实际操作示例,帮助你更好地理解和应用上述方法。

  1. 示例一:简单复制粘贴公式

    假设在A1单元格中有一个公式=A2+B2,现在需要将这个公式复制到B1单元格。

    • 选择A1单元格,按Ctrl+C复制。
    • 选择B1单元格,按Ctrl+V粘贴。
    • 检查B1单元格中的公式,发现公式变为=B2+C2。这是因为使用了相对引用。
  2. 示例二:使用绝对引用

    假设在A1单元格中有一个公式=$A$2+$B$2,现在需要将这个公式复制到B1单元格。

    • 选择A1单元格,按Ctrl+C复制。
    • 选择B1单元格,按Ctrl+V粘贴。
    • 检查B1单元格中的公式,发现公式仍然是=$A$2+$B$2。这是因为使用了绝对引用。
  3. 示例三:使用粘贴选项

    假设在A1单元格中有一个公式=A2+B2,现在需要将这个公式复制到B1单元格,并保留B1单元格的格式。

    • 选择A1单元格,按Ctrl+C复制。
    • 在B1单元格右键单击,选择“粘贴选项”中的“公式”图标。
    • 检查B1单元格中的公式,发现公式变为=B2+C2,同时B1单元格的格式保持不变。
  4. 示例四:使用快捷键

    假设在A1单元格中有一个公式=A2+B2,现在需要将这个公式复制到B1单元格。

    • 选择A1单元格,按Ctrl+C复制。
    • 选择B1单元格,按Ctrl+Shift+V打开“粘贴特殊”对话框,选择“公式”选项。
    • 检查B1单元格中的公式,发现公式变为=B2+C2。

七、高级应用:跨工作表复制粘贴

在实际工作中,有时需要在不同工作表之间复制粘贴公式。这时需要特别注意单元格引用方式。

  1. 相对引用

    假设在Sheet1的A1单元格中有一个公式=Sheet2!A1+B1,现在需要将这个公式复制到Sheet1的B1单元格。

    • 选择A1单元格,按Ctrl+C复制。
    • 选择B1单元格,按Ctrl+V粘贴。
    • 检查B1单元格中的公式,发现公式变为=Sheet2!B1+C1。
  2. 绝对引用

    假设在Sheet1的A1单元格中有一个公式=Sheet2!$A$1+$B$1,现在需要将这个公式复制到Sheet1的B1单元格。

    • 选择A1单元格,按Ctrl+C复制。
    • 选择B1单元格,按Ctrl+V粘贴。
    • 检查B1单元格中的公式,发现公式仍然是=Sheet2!$A$1+$B$1。

八、使用VBA进行批量复制粘贴

在某些情况下,可能需要进行大量的复制粘贴操作。此时可以考虑使用VBA(Visual Basic for Applications)进行批量处理。

  1. 录制宏

    Excel提供了录制宏的功能,可以将一系列操作录制为VBA代码。具体步骤如下:

    • 在“开发工具”选项卡中,点击“录制宏”按钮。
    • 进行需要的复制粘贴操作。
    • 停止录制宏。
  2. 编辑宏

    录制宏后,可以在VBA编辑器中对宏进行编辑。例如,可以将录制的代码修改为循环,以实现批量处理。

    Sub BatchCopyPaste()

    Dim i As Integer

    For i = 1 To 10

    Sheets("Sheet1").Cells(i, 1).Copy

    Sheets("Sheet2").Cells(i, 1).PasteSpecial Paste:=xlPasteFormulas

    Next i

    End Sub

  3. 运行宏

    在VBA编辑器中,点击“运行”按钮即可执行宏,完成批量复制粘贴操作。

九、总结

在Excel中复制粘贴公式的方法多种多样,包括直接复制粘贴、使用快捷键、通过粘贴选项控制粘贴内容等。理解相对引用和绝对引用的区别是避免公式错误的关键。通过实际操作示例和高级应用场景的介绍,相信你已经对如何在Excel中复制粘贴公式有了深入的了解和掌握。在需要批量处理时,可以考虑使用VBA进行自动化操作,提高工作效率。

相关问答FAQs:

1. 如何在Excel中复制粘贴公式?
在Excel中复制粘贴公式非常简单。首先,选择包含公式的单元格或单元格范围。然后,点击复制按钮(通常是Ctrl+C),或者右键单击并选择复制选项。接下来,在要粘贴公式的目标单元格或单元格范围中,点击粘贴按钮(通常是Ctrl+V),或者右键单击并选择粘贴选项。Excel会自动将公式复制到目标单元格中,并相应地调整公式中的单元格引用。

2. 如何在Excel中复制公式但不调整单元格引用?
如果希望复制公式时保持原始单元格引用不变,可以使用绝对引用。在编辑公式时,使用美元符号($)来锁定特定的行或列。例如,如果要将A1单元格的公式复制到B1单元格,但保持对A1的引用不变,可以将公式中的A1改为$A$1。然后,按照上述步骤复制粘贴公式,新的公式将保持对A1的引用,而不会根据目标单元格的位置调整。

3. 如何在Excel中只复制公式而不复制值?
有时候,我们需要复制包含公式的单元格,而不是复制计算后的值。为了实现这一点,在复制前先确保目标单元格的格式为公式格式。然后,按照上述步骤复制粘贴公式。这样,目标单元格将保留原始公式,并根据需要重新计算。如果目标单元格的格式为常规格式,则会复制公式的计算结果而不是公式本身。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4357769

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部